Understanding the Austin Relocation Landscape
Before you start packing your boxes, it is essential to understand the Austin relocation landscape. The city has a unique charm, but it also has its challenges. From traffic congestion to housing availability, being informed can help you navigate your move more effectively.
Austin is known for its rapid growth. This means that housing can be competitive. Researching neighborhoods ahead of time can save you a lot of stress. Popular areas like South Congress, East Austin, and the Domain each offer different vibes and amenities.
Consider what is most important to you. Do you want to be close to work, schools, or entertainment? Make a list of your priorities to help narrow down your options.
Planning Your Move
Once you have a good understanding of the city, it is time to plan your move. A well-thought-out plan can significantly reduce stress. Here are some steps to consider:
Create a Timeline: Start by setting a moving date. Work backward to create a timeline for packing, hiring movers, and setting up utilities.
Budget for Your Move: Moving can be expensive. Create a budget that includes moving truck rentals, packing supplies, and any professional services you may need.
Declutter Before You Pack: Moving is a great opportunity to declutter. Go through your belongings and decide what to keep, donate, or sell. This will make packing easier and reduce the amount you need to move.
Gather Packing Supplies: Collect boxes, tape, and packing materials. You can often find free boxes at local stores or online marketplaces.
Label Everything: As you pack, label each box with its contents and the room it belongs to. This will make unpacking much easier.

Navigating Austin's Neighborhoods
Austin is a city of diverse neighborhoods, each with its own character. Here are a few popular areas to consider when relocating:
Downtown Austin: Known for its vibrant nightlife, restaurants, and cultural attractions, downtown is perfect for those who want to be in the heart of the action.
South Austin: This area is known for its eclectic vibe, food trucks, and live music. It is a great choice for those who enjoy a laid-back lifestyle.
North Austin: If you prefer a quieter environment, North Austin offers family-friendly neighborhoods with parks and good schools.
East Austin: This up-and-coming area is known for its art scene and trendy cafes. It is a great choice for young professionals and creatives.
Take the time to explore these neighborhoods to find the one that feels like home.
Setting Up Utilities and Services
Once you have secured your new home, it is time to set up utilities and services. Here are some essential services to consider:
Electricity and Water: Contact local providers to set up your electricity and water services. In Austin, you have several options for electricity providers.
Internet and Cable: Research internet and cable providers in your area. Many companies offer bundle deals that can save you money.
Trash and Recycling: Check with the city for trash and recycling services. Austin has a robust recycling program, so be sure to familiarize yourself with the guidelines.
Home Security: Consider installing a home security system for peace of mind. Many companies offer smart home options that you can control from your phone.
Embracing the Austin Lifestyle
Once you have settled into your new home, it is time to embrace the Austin lifestyle. The city offers a wealth of activities and experiences. Here are some ways to get involved:
Explore the Outdoors: Austin is known for its beautiful parks and outdoor spaces. Visit Zilker Park, hike the Barton Creek Greenbelt, or take a stroll along Lady Bird Lake.
Attend Local Events: Austin hosts numerous events throughout the year, including music festivals, food fairs, and art shows. Check local calendars to find events that interest you.
Join Community Groups: Getting involved in community groups or clubs is a great way to meet new people. Look for groups that align with your interests, whether it is sports, arts, or volunteering.
Taste the Local Cuisine: Austin is famous for its food scene. Be sure to try local favorites like barbecue, Tex-Mex, and food trucks.

Finding Your New Favorite Spots
Once you are settled in, take the time to explore your new city. Austin is full of hidden gems waiting to be discovered. Here are some suggestions:
Coffee Shops: Austin has a thriving coffee culture. Visit local favorites like Houndstooth Coffee or Jo's Coffee for a great cup of joe.
Parks and Trails: Explore the many parks and trails in the area. The Ann and Roy Butler Hike-and-Bike Trail is a popular spot for walking, running, and biking.
Live Music Venues: Austin is known as the "Live Music Capital of the World." Check out venues like The Continental Club or Mohawk for live performances.
Local Markets: Visit local farmers' markets to find fresh produce and handmade goods. The Texas Farmers' Market at Mueller is a great option.
